Description:

Description for B&B:

We have two generously sized and cozy rooms available, each equipped with its own shower and toilet. In addition, there is a shared kitchen for your convenience.

To help you unwind and enjoy your stay, we offer a charming garden area with comfortable seating and sun loungers, as well as the option to relax on either the outdoor or indoor terrace.

Furthermore, we take pride in serving homemade products during breakfast, providing you with a delightful start to your day.

Don't miss out on our recommended tours and local discoveries in the surrounding area, ensuring you make the most of your visit. If desired, we can also arrange for wine and goat cheese upon request.

Notes: The beautiful Atlantic Coast promises you sweet and soothing nights. It has a double bed and a private bathroom. Rates (breakfast included) : 1 pers : 59 , 2 pers. : 66
Notes: The lovely Marais Poitevin enjoys a cozy and relaxing environment. 1 double bed and 1 single bed, 1 private bathroom. Rates (breakfast included) 1 pers 62 , 2 pers 70 , 3 pers 78

Attractions

  • Château de Saint-Mesmin: Located in Saint-Mesmin, this medieval castle offers visitors a chance to explore its well-preserved architecture and learn about its rich history through guided tours and exhibits.
  • Marais Poitevin: Also known as the "Green Venice," this unique marshland area is a popular destination for nature enthusiasts. Visitors can explore the canals by boat or kayak, surrounded by lush greenery and diverse wildlife.
  • Puy du Fou: Situated in Les Epesses, Puy du Fou is a historical theme park that offers immersive experiences through spectacular shows and reenactments. From Roman gladiator battles to medieval jousting tournaments, this park provides a thrilling journey through time.
  • Futuroscope: Located in Chasseneuil-du-Poitou, Futuroscope is a futuristic theme park offering a range of multimedia experiences and innovative attractions. Visitors can enjoy 3D and 4D cinema, virtual reality rides, and interactive exhibits.
  • Abbaye Royale de Fontevraud: This impressive abbey, located in Fontevraud-l'Abbaye, is one of the largest monastic complexes in Europe. Visitors can explore the beautiful Romanesque architecture, learn about its history, and visit the tombs of prominent historical figures.
  • Château de Brézé: Situated in Brézé, this unique castle features an underground fortress and a network of underground tunnels. Visitors can take guided tours to discover the castle's medieval architecture, beautiful gardens, and vineyards.
  • Parc Oriental de Maulévrier: Known as the largest Japanese garden in Europe, this peaceful park in Maulévrier offers visitors a serene experience with its traditional Japanese landscaping, pagodas, and tranquil ponds.
  • Château d'Oiron: Located in Oiron, this Renaissance castle houses contemporary art exhibitions within its historic walls. Visitors can admire the stunning architecture while appreciating the modern art installations.
